American Drama 1714 to 1915 via ProQuest/Chadwyck-Healey

Currently containing more than 1,100 dramatic works from the early eighteenth century up  to the beginning of the twentieth, American Drama 1714-1915 reflects American dramatic writing in all its richness and diversity: plays in verse, farces, melodramas, minstrel shows, realist plays, frontier plays, temperance dialogues and a range of other genres ... American Periodicals Series, 1740-1900

American Periodicals Series Online, 1740-1900 includes digitized images of the pages of American magazines and journals published from colonial days to the dawn of the 20th century. Published between 1741 and 1900, the more than 1,000 titles include Benjamin Franklin's General Magazine, the first American professional journals, and several popular magazines still in publication, such as Vanity Fai... American Poetry, 1600-1900

American Poetry, 1600-1900 This new resource contains over 40,000 poems by more than 200 poets, covering the Colonial period to the early twentieth century, and drawn from over 1,200 printed sources. Asian American Drama Database, late 19th c. -

This edition of Asian American Drama contains 70 plays by 17 playwrights, together with detailed, fielded information on related productions, theaters, production companies, and more. When complete, the collection will include more than 250 plays, of which some 50% have never been published before. The database also includes selected playbills, production photographs an...
